There is part of me that is ashamed to be human.
My first instinct is one of pure hatred and a lust for vicious, violent retribution.
I want to kill them all.
This is simply genocide. A weak Zaghawa being purged by the Janjawid, supported by China because of oil interests.
Those who survive these massacres will join the rebels, and will fight a pyrrhic war of resistance; never having the strength, logistics or material to deal a crushing blow to their enemy.
Villages and communities will continue to be decimated. Agriculture will wither on the vine, and with it, more famine. Hundreds of thousands, if not millions, will die. Their fate has been written and sealed by this vile conflict, just through the chance that they were born of the wrong creed in the wrong country.
Because of China's influence nothing will be done. Nothing will be done to stop families being torn apart; nothing will stop the necessity of the child soldiers.
This is not about color. The genocide in Rwanda was allowed to continue because of the fat lip the US and the UN received in Mogadishu.
What is to be done? I don't know. It will play itself out eventually. But at what cost? Being a father, this picture really resonates with me.

This boy is my son's age. There are hundreds of thousands of kids like this, and in the story linked above, suffering through the accidental location of their birth.
What can you do? Give money? Food aid is always used as a weapon by those on the ground. Write to your congressperson? I don't know. But spare a thought for these people tonight.
